Fig. 2. Radiomics and deep learning in clinical workflow and their roles in existing diagnostic pathways.
Replacement: deep learning-based tumor volumetry has potential to replace human-derived manual tumor volumetry for defining image-based progression and non-progression. Triage: deep learning-based metastasis detection has potential to triage patients and identify those whose imaging needs to be read first and may increase radiologists' specificity and reduce tiredness. Add-on: radiogenomics applications have potential to stratify further high-risk and low-risk groups and may help guide patient management. Adapted from Bossuyt et al. BMJ 2006;332:1089-1092 (34).
